    Becoming an Avid Certified User for Pro Tools verifies that you possess a fundamental understanding of and the capability to use Avid Pro Tools to engineer a project through to completion, with all of the fundamental operational skills to record, edit, mix and output the finished session. Providing you with an industry recognized credential for both academic users and industry professionals.

    To gain the title of Avid Certified Specialist for Pro Tools, you must take two foundational courses, Pro Tools Fundamentals I (PT101) and Pro Tools Fundamentals II (PT110), before sitting and passing the associated certification exam.

    This course delivers a comprehensive introduction to the studio production workflow. Topics covered include; Consoles, Signal Flow, Microphones, Recording Techniques and basic Mixing. On completion of this course, students will learn the tools and basic setup to successfully conduct a recording session.

    This course introduces students to contemporary editing & mixing techniques in music production using the industry standard Pro Tools software. Topics include; mixing concepts, internal 'in the box' signal routing, automation, signal processors, and signal processing techniques.
